Second Meeting of Legislative Council Session to Discuss National Development Agenda

BSB

 

 

 

The Legislative Council informs that His Majesty Sultan Haji Hassanal Bolkiah Mu'izzaddin Waddaulah ibni Al-Marhum Sultan Haji Omar 'Ali Saifuddien Sa'adul Khairi Waddien, Sultan and Yang Di-Pertuan of Brunei Darussalam has consented for the Second Meeting of the 21st Legislative Council Session to begin on Monday, 10th Safar 1447 Hijrah corresponding to 4th of August 2025, at the Dewan Majlis, Jalan Dewan Majlis.

 

The Second Meeting will focus on Queries, Minister Statements and Formal Proposals, which among other matters discusses the national development agenda through deliberation sessions. Members of the Legislative Council will have the opportunity to deliberate on current issues, proposals and views towards issues of interest to the people and country.

 

The session will be chaired by Yang Berhormat Pehin Orang Kaya Seri Lela Dato Seri Setia Awang Haji Abdul Rahman bin Dato Setia Haji Mohamed Taib, Speaker of the Legislative Council and assisted by Doctor Dayang Hajah Huraini binti Pehin Orang Kaya Setia Jaya Dato Paduka Awang Haji Hurairah, Clerk to the Privy Council, Secretary to the Cabinet Ministers Council and Clerk to the Legislative Council. Members of the Legislative Council comprise Ex-Officio members and Appointed Members, including Titled Persons, Persons Who Have Achieved Distinction as well as District Representatives, who will convene in a harmonious atmosphere to review various issues and policies in achieving the agenda in the interest of the citizens and prosperity of the country.

 

The second Legislative Council session is open to the public. Those who are interested are welcomed to attend the session to witness the deliberations at Dewan Persidangan starting the 4th of August. Translation service to English is also available by applying for it 24 hours before attending the session.

 

Education institutions are invited to bring their students as an exposure on the Legislative Council, including the national legislative process, and deliberations within the Dewan Persidangan. Visit application can be made by writing an official letter to the Legislative Council Secretariat at least 5 days before the date of visit.

 

The daily session's recordings are available via RTB Perdana and RTB Sukmaindera at 9 in the evening for the morning session, and 11 at night for the afternoon session. Official documents such as Hansard, Minute of Meetings, and Order of the Day are available at 'councils.gov.bn'. The latest information and development will also be published at the official Instagram, '@LegcoBrunei'.

 

Visitors and the public who are attending the LegCo session are advised to adhere to the rules and guidelines, including the dress code, and the procedure when entering the Dewan Persidangan.
